Out one afternoon to buy and consume in online stores is an act so widespread and common as harmless, however, according to a study, 7% of the population may have a disorder related to purchases, and between affected people, eight out of ten are women. Input data do not seem to be taken lightly, but then, why the addiction to shopping does not arouse the same media attention and other addictions?

It is still early to be clear … or so it seems

When it comes to determining a chemical addiction, doctors, psychologists and psychiatrists have few diagnostic criteria that serve as their guide, as well as protocols for prevention and treatment. Instead about shopping addiction I still have not reached a strong consensus among professionals about whether it is an addiction or an impulse control disorder or conduct.

It was not until the latest version of DSM-5 (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ders), published in 2013, which has had a category relating to non-substance-related disorders, in which the disorder is included game, which opens the door to future diagnoses of other behavioral addictions like shopping, internet, sex …

But for now there is no agreement on key points such as whether the behavior associated is totally impulsive or includes planned actions, if part of the reward circuitry of the common drugs rather than used to relieve anxiety and other problems, or if appropriate to treat or not with drugs … In short, there is still much to investigate and learn.

It is not easy to separate normal from pathological

If a friend tells us to be alone every day bingo, or who likes to drink half a bottle of vodka every night, we will surely trigger all alarms and will relate these behaviors with an addiction, but instead, if we realize that it has bought four pairs of shoes today, yesterday three coats in an online store and that tomorrow will pass through the center to look things most likely to cause envy us.

In a world in which reigns materialistic culture and consumption, buying more than necessary (even much more than necessary) is not associated with a problem, rather successful and high social status. Another thing is that after accumulating debts and the situation is complicated to the point of ruin life.

We have no doubt that smoking is bad, but shopping? Shopping is great! Active economy, makes us happy, makes us see more beautiful … Some experts differ compulsive buying normal that the first is not rational, but how many purchases we usually do habitually they are? The line between normal and pathological is sometimes very diffuse and even more difficult to differentiate when you consider that since the beginning of an addictive problem until acknowledged spend an average of 13 years.
